Recognizing what is pcb what is it in practical terms means looking at how a design becomes a physical product. The pcb fabrication process begins with layout and design, proceeds via patterning and etching copper, drilling holes, layering vias, and applying solder mask, and ends with assessment and screening. The printed motherboard fabrication process and pcb manufacturing process steps are closely relevant, yet fabrication normally describes making the bare board while assembly involves attaching electronic elements. The pcb board manufacturing process, pcb manufacture process, and pcb production process all explain this broader journey from electronic design to end up equipment. For engineers and buying groups, knowing the pcb manufacturing steps is very important due to the fact that it helps with cost, lead time, and quality planning.

An additional major group is flexible pcb board technology. Flexible pcbs, flexible pcb assembly, flexible printed circuit assembly, and flexible circuit assembly all describe circuits built on flexible substrates such as kapton flex pcb materials. These boards serve when space is tight or when a device has to move, fold up, or vibrate. A flexi pcb can make it through repeated flexing far better than a conventional rigid board, making it important in wearables, cams, automotive electronics, and medical tools. There are additionally essential design factors to consider around rigid flex pcb design guidelines and hdi pcb board supplier option. If a board has flex sections, the developer must represent bend radius, layer shifts, copper equilibrium, and coverlay choice. If a board is densely transmitted, the stackup must support fine lines, microvia reliability, and thermal performance. High reliability flexible circuits and custom etched flex circuits are particularly pertinent in items that must endure vibration, duplicated activity, or rough environments. Rigid flex pcb supplier option must be based on shown experience with material handling, lamination, drilling, and assembly of blended rigid and flex frameworks.
